آیا شبکه بلاکچین امن است؟

آیا شبکه بلاکچین امن است؟
  • 1401/11/24
  • گویا آی تی
  • 0

بلاکچین چیست؟

حتماً در چند سال اخیر در مورد ارز دیجیتال و فناوری بلاکچین، چیزهایی شنیده‌اید. بلاکچین به‌طور کلی یک دفتر کل توزیع‌شده، عمومی ‌و غیرمتمرکز است. اگر کلمه بلاکچین (Blockchain) را به دو قسمت تقسیم کنید، کلمه بلاک (Block) و چین (Chain) به وجود می‌آید. درنتیجه، معنی کلمه بلاکچین، زنجیره بلاک (زنجیره بلوک) به‌دست می‌آید. در‌واقع منظور از بلاکچین، زنجیره‌‌ایی از اطلاعات دیجیتالی است که در آن هر بلاک وظیفه نگهداری اطلاعات را بر عهده دارد. به‌طور دقیق‌تر، یک دفتر کل زنجیره‌ای توزیع‌شده، اشتراکی و غیرمتمرکز را که از سوابقی به نام بلاک ساخته شده، بلاکچین می‌گویند.

هر بلاک، اطلاعات ویژه‌ای مثلاً سوابق معاملات که شامل تاریخ، زمان، اطلاعات فروشندگان و خریداران در معاملات و مبلغ خرید شما از سایت می‌شود را ذخیره می‌کند. البته توجه داشته باشید که مثلاً اگر دو خرید یکسان انجام دهید، هر بلاک با کد منحصر‌به‌فردی به نام هش، اطلاعات آن را به‌صورت جداگانه ذخیره می‌کند. این در حالی است که یک بلاک، می‌تواند حجم خاصی از داده را ذخیره کند؛ یعنی با توجه به‌ اندازه معامله، یک بلاک واحد می‌تواند چند هزار تراکنش را در خود ذخیره کند. در معاملات، به‌جای استفاده از نام واقعی شما از امضای دیجیتال منحصربه‌فرد استفاده می‌شود.

بلاک چین

امنیت بلاکچین

افراد در مورد اعتماد و امنیت شبکه بلاکچین، سؤالات بسیاری دارند. درواقع این طبیعی است. گفتیم که بلاکچین به‌صورت زنجیره است، پس بلاک‌های جدید به‌صورت خطی به انتهای زنجیره اضافه می‌شوند؛ یعنی در انتهای زنجیره، همیشه جدیدترین بلاک وجود دارد. اگر یک بلاک به انتهای زنجیره اضافه شود، حذف کردن آن یا حتی ویرایش و تغییر محتوای آن بسیار دشوار است؛ چراکه هر بلاک، هش مخصوص به خود و هش بلاک قبل از خود را شامل می‌شود. شاید برایتان سؤال شود که اصلا هش چیست؟

توسط یک عملکرد ریاضی (تابع هش)، کد‌های هش ایجاد شده و به همین دلیل اطلاعات دیجیتال به محاسبات، اعداد و حرف‌های ریاضی تبدیل می‌شوند. درصورتی‌که اطلاعات بلاک تغییر کند، کد هش نیز تغییر می‌کند که این موضوع به امنیت بلاکچین برمی‌گردد. برای مثال اگر یک هکر قصد داشته باشد به هدف پرداخت مجدد هزینه توسط شما، اطلاعات بلاک را ویرایش کند، به‌محض اینکه مقدار تومان معامله شما را تغییر داد، هش بلاک هم تغییر می‌کند. بلاک بعدی، هش قدیمی ‌را در خود جای می‌دهد و هکر برای اینکه بتواند تغییرات را به نتیجه برساند، باید به‌روزرسانی بلاک قدیمی‌ را هم انجام دهد؛ یعنی باید هش این بلاک را هم تغییر دهد.

شبکه بلاکچین

درنتیجه یک هکر برای تغییر یک بلاک، باید بلاک بعد از آن را نیز تغییر دهد. ازآنجایی‌که برای تغییر بلاک، هش باید تغییر کند و تغییر هش، انرژی محاسباتی بسیار زیاد و غیرقابل‌تصوری را می‌طلبد، صرفه اقتصادی برای هکرها ندارد؛ درنتیجه بلاکچین بسیار امن است.

 

الگوریتم اجماع در بلاکچین

در مسئله اعتماد و امنیت، برای کامپیوترهایی که می‌خواهند به انواع شبکه‌ بلاکچین متصل شوند و بلاک‌های جدیدی به زنجیره اضافه کنند، تست‌هایی در نظر گرفته‌شده است. به این تست‌ها، الگوریتم اجماع (consensus models) می‌گویند. این تست کاربر را مجبور می‌کند که قبل از اضافه کردن بلاک و شرکت در یک شبکه Blockchain، خود را ثابت کند؛ یعنی کامپیوتر‌ها باید اثبات کنند که به حل یک مسئله پیچیده ریاضی مسلط هستند. درصورتی‌که کامپیوتر بتواند این مسئله را حل کند، می‌تواند یک بلاک به شبکه بلاکچین نیز اضافه کند.

البته توجه داشته باشید که افزودن بلاک در جهان کریپتوکارنسی که ماینینگ (Minig) نامیده می‌شود، به‌هیچ‌عنوان آسان نیست. اثبات کار، حمله هکر را غیرممکن نمی‌کند، اما حمله‌ها را تا حدود زیادی بی‌فایده می‌کند؛ چرا‌که شانس حل مسئله ریاضی، ۱ در ۵٫۸ تریلیون است. همچنین هزینه‌ای که برای این حمله صرف می‌شود، از مزایای آن چند برابر است. الگوریتم اجماع در شبکه بلاکچین اهمیت زیادی را دارد. از‌این‌رو نقطه قوت بلاکچین محسوب می‌شود و امنیت بلاکچین را تضمین می‌کند. الگوریتم اجماع به دو دسته الگوریتم گواه اثبات کار (PoW) و الگوریتم گواه اثبات سهام (PoS) تقسیم می‌شود.

 

آیا امکان دارد اثبات کار توسط هکرها در بلاکچین انجام شود؟

هکر‌ها با استفاده از حق اکثریت که به آن حمله ۵۱ درصدی (%۵۱ attack) گفته می‌شود، می‌توانند بلاک‌ها را تغییر دهند. حال سؤال اینجاست که این حمله چگونه اتفاق می‌افتد؟ مثلاً اگر در یک شبکه بیت کوین، پنج میلیون کامپیوتر وجود داشته باشد، هکر برای دستیابی به اکثریت باید ۲٫۵ میلیون آن را هک کند. برای این کار، هکر یا گروهی از هکرها، در روند ثبت معاملات جدید دخالت می‌کنند. یعنی ابتدا معامله‌ای را انجام می‌دهند و سپس همان معامله را دست‌کاری می‌کنند. درواقع با این صحنه‌سازی قصد دارند ثابت کنند که ارز دیجیتالی که قبلاً برای شخص دیگری ارسال کردند، هنوز هم وجود دارد.

این فرایند، دو بار خرج کردن یا خرج کردن مضاعف نامیده می‌شود. یعنی جعل دیجیتال اتفاق می‌افتاد و کاربر می‌تواند بیت کوین‌های خود را بیشتر از یک‌بار خرج کند. اجرای چنین حمله‌ای در بلاکچین برای یک هکر که باید میلیون‌ها کامپیوتر را در دست بگیرید، بسیار دشوار است. از زمانی که بیت کوین معرفی شد و اولین بلاک آن استخراج شد، بیشتر از ده سال می‌گذرد و در این مدت هیچ حمله ۵۱ درصدی و دست‌کاری در بلاک‌های بلاکچین اتفاق نیفتاده است.

 

آینده فناوری بلاکچین

فناوری بلاکچین، اصلی‌ترین عامل در شبکه‌های کریپتوکارنسی محسوب می‌شود. کوین‌ها و توکن‌های جدیدی که در بازار ایجاد می‌شوند، از قابلیت‌های جدیدتر، کامل و دقیق‌تر بلاکچین استفاده می‌کنند. در آینده هم‌زمان با افزایش محبوبیت متاورس و البته NFT‌ها، تغییرات گسترده‌ای در بلاکچین ایجاد می‌شود که البته آن را بهبود می‌بخشد. درنهایت باید بگوییم که آینده بلاکچین کاملاً روشن است و افراد در آینده در حوزه‌های مختلف از آن استفاده می‌کنند.‌

 

سخن پایانی

تیم والکس (شرکت خلق ثروت سرزمین پارسه) بهترین تیم در زمینه برنامه‌نویسی، ارز دیجیتال، مدیریت و مالی است. ایرانیان به دلیل ناآگاهی بسیاری که در مورد بازار‌های خارجی دارند و با همین ناآگاهی دست به خریدوفروش می‌زنند، بدون اینکه به کلاه‌برداران توجه‌‌ای کنند، بسیار ضرر می‌کنند. تیم والکس، با ایجاد پلتفرم و بستری امن، معامله‌ها، خریدوفروش بیت کوین، سایر ارزهای دیجیتال و حفظ دارایی‌های مشتریان را به خوبی و با امنیت کامل انجام می‌دهد.

توجه داشته باشید که این اطلاعات علاوه بر اینکه رمزنگاری و ذخیره می‌شوند، بسیار سریع به کاربر اطلاع‌رسانی می‌شوند و کاربر هم در جریان قرار می‌گیرد. علاوه بر این مشاوران والکس، به سؤالات شما پاسخ می‌دهند و به بهترین نحو شما را راهنمایی می‌کنند تا با انجام معاملات مطمئن، آینده‌ای پرسود داشته باشید.

دیدگاه خود را وارد کنید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*